Fluid-Structure Interaction of Composite Structures

This is the first book presenting dynamic responses and failure of polymer composite structures as they interact with internal and/or external fluid media. It summarizes authoritative research carried out by the author in the past decade on various aspects of Fluid-Structure Interaction (FSI) to present important effects of FSI on composite structures. The topics include impact loading on composite structures with air-back, water-back, or containing water; FSI effects on frequencies, mode shapes, and modal curvatures; cyclic loading for fatigue failure with FSI; coupling of independent composite structures by fluid media; and moving composite structures in water. Numerical techniques for FSI are also presented. Research was conducted both experimentally and numerically to complement each other. The book offers a timely, comprehensive information to fluid-structure interaction of composite structures for students, researchers or practicing engineers.
